VietNam calls for Japan's support in building North-South express railway

Hanoi, January 14, 2023(AseanAll)-Vietnamese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h called on the Japanese Government to support Viet Nam in building the North-South express railway.

Vietnamese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h (R) hosts a reception for Japan’s Minister of Finance Suzuki Shunichi, HaNoi, January 13, 2023 - Photo: VGP


According to the Vietnamese government portal(VGP),The Government chief made the request during his reception for Japan’s Minister of Finance Suzuki Shunichi in Ha Noi on Friday(January 13).


Pham expressed his delight at the strong and comprehensive development of Viet Nam-Japan comprehensive strategic partnership for peace and prosperity in Asia with high political trust.


VietNam considers Japan as a top and long-term strategic partnership, backing Japan to make active contribution to peace, cooperation and development in the region and the world, he affirmed.


The host reiterated that Viet Nam will continue creating favorable conditions for Japanese firms to launch effective operation in the country.


The Prime Minister Pham suggested the two countries organize practical activities to mark the 50th founding anniversary of diplomatic ties this year.


He suggested Japan assist Viet Nam in restructuring capital contributions at Nghi Son refinery and petrochemical project, and enhancing digital transformation in customs, corporate bond and securities markets.


For his part, Suzuki Shunichi spoke highly of the Vietnamese Government's efforts in the COVID-19 fight and socio-economic recovery.


He also briefed the host about the outcomes of his working session with Vietnamese Minister of Finance Ho Duc Phoc, asserting that the two sides will continue fostering collaboration in infrastructure development.
